Pity the summit is not 1km away along the ridge in Plant World Gardens where in 1986 was built and planted the first ever ‘Map-of-the World Gardens’. Visitors (for £3) navigate the winding pathways around the ‘world map’ and thus see which plants grow in which countries. An 80 foot eucalyptus from Australia has shot up in under 40 years. The strong, overpowering curry smell from the Escallonia viscosa tree baffles all visitors, as it is only evident if you stand downwind, and not at all when you touch it! Their hill top cafe makes the proud boast that it must offer one of the most incredible panoramas in the country, with unbeatable views of the Teign estuary and the twin peaks of Haytor rising above Dartmoor.Chris Pearson04/03/2024

Small pull-in to SE at SX 9041 6877 (room for 1 car) - NW along road for about 300m to drive entrance (last 60m or so narrow with little verge & fast traffic!) - Entrance gate is padlocked, fitted with steel mesh & topped with barbed wire, so went over old wooden gate on left into adjacent field & up alongside hedge to top corner at SX 90162 69013. This is about 12m from the summit gateway which is visible through hedge; looks to be same height. (S)gerrybowes15/06/2021
